Context Denver is a light industrial area located along the eastern edge of a broad industrial belt spanning the southern extent of Johannesburg’s CBD. It sits adjacent to the historic east/west gold mining axis (known as the ‘main reef’). This industrial belt (buffer) is embedded into the surrounding urban fabric, simultaneously woven and disconnected by multiple forces: mine dumps, railways, arterials, freeways and storm water channels.

UNIT 2 UDF
The urban design framework was further broken down into individual briefs which were split into 3 residential open building typologies. The first being the alteration of the existing men’s hostel, the second was the implementation of 4-story walk-up units with retail on the ground floor and thirdly the implementation of mixed-use row houses that would comprise of private and public/commercial spaces. The designs had to respond to the existing context of the area, through spatial planning, through materials that are used and are available in the area, just to name a few.

The mixed-use row houses that I designed had a commercial
and public program on the ground floor and a private residential program on the
first and second floors. On the ground floor I proposed a community library as
well as a small café that is adjoined to the library. The café spilled out on
the public walk way that runs from east to west through our urban design
framework and leads to the community vegetable garden.
Ground Floor Library & First Floor Residential Plans
On the upper two floors
I proposed private residential houses that could be used as a single house over
two floors that could accommodate for a relatively big family, between 4 and 6
persons. The houses could also be split across two floors, so a single dwelling
on the first floor and another single dwelling on the second floor, of which
each dwelling would be able to function as a bachelor pad or a and could accommodate
up to a small family of about 3 persons.
I decided to propose the use of steel framed construction
for the structure of the row houses. I found that this was the closest
construction method to the structure and metal use in the construction of the
shacks in Denver, while at the same time it allowed for the best variation and
flexibility for in-fill in both the residential and public/commercial programs
on their respective floors. The use of steel framed construction also allowed
for significant variations in the materiality that could be used for the
mixed-use row houses. Materials I proposed to use were corten steel panels,
corrugated sheet metal, brickwork, timber panels and plywood panels.
Levels are a part
of our everyday lives and can be seen around us all the time. They form a hierarchy
that affects everything we do and how we do those things. The top levels
determine the parameters of every other level that is beneath it. Levels can be
seen as themes, because they categorize and frame specific elements and
features. Levels are an essential part to open building and they can influence
the success or failure of the design of the building, while at the same time
they also reveal the order in which things are built or installed and thus
their importance within the construction process.

Capacity
Working together
with people who stay and work in an area will help to determine the levels that
influence your design within the ecosystem of the area. The capacity of the
design intervention will determine its success in response to the current times
as well as its success in the future, whether it remains the same or is altered
or added to in the future. In terms of capacity in open building, it is the
flexibility that the base building creates in order for various configurations
of in fill to create new spaces that can serve different functions. Capacity relates to the design of a building
or intervention and its success within the ecosystem.
